Director, Network and User Support
Position Summary
University Development and Alumni Relations (UDAR) is dedicated to soliciting the private funding necessary to support the strategic goals of the University in teaching, learning, and research. The personnel of UDAR work university-wide as well as within individual schools and colleges of the University to discover, motivate, cultivate, solicit, and steward alumni, parents, faculty, and friends for immediate, long-range, and future financial support, through gifts and pledges to the University, for critical operations such as student aid, faculty support, academic and research program development, and facilities and infrastructure. UDAR's endeavors raise funds for immediate University use and also for the University's endowment.
The Director, Network and User Support will lead a team responsible for delivering comprehensive IT and user support services to University Development and Alumni Relations. Oversee user training, technology asset management, vendor and contract management, information security, server administration, and site-support operations. Lead the development and application of security frameworks for UDAR’s networks, on-premises systems, cloud environments, and SaaS integrations, ensuring compliance with NYU’s policies. Determine the network and computing impact of implementation of new systems, review hardware and software proposals from vendors, recommend appropriate network solutions to UDAR leadership, and direct the development of installation schedules and priorities with the goal of improving network and compute reliability, availability, security, and maintainability.
